What’s happening now

For operations teams managing a vendor network, the daily reality is a relentless stream of supplier communications that demand attention without offering much signal about where to focus first. Quotes arrive in varying formats. Invoices come in as PDF attachments that someone has to open, read, and reconcile against a purchase order. Delivery confirmations land in an inbox alongside renewal notices, pricing updates, and the occasional dispute. None of it is organized, and most of it requires a human to extract the relevant facts before anything useful can happen.

The result is that procurement and operations staff spend a disproportionate share of their time on information extraction — pulling numbers out of documents, comparing them to what was agreed, and flagging exceptions — rather than on the supplier relationships and sourcing decisions that actually shape costs and supply chain resilience. At small and mid-sized companies, where operations staff tend to wear many hats, this overhead compounds quickly.

Manual processes also introduce inconsistency. Whether a purchase order gets matched correctly, whether a pricing discrepancy gets caught before payment, and whether a supplier response gets followed up in a timely way often depends on who is working that day and how busy they are. Process quality should not be that variable.

How an AI agent can be deployed

A vendor and procurement AI agent integrates with your email, document storage, and ERP or procurement system to handle the data extraction and monitoring work that currently occupies staff time. It watches incoming supplier communications, pulls out the structured information your team needs, checks it against your records, and escalates exceptions — without requiring a person to open every email and read every attachment.

  • Supplier communication monitoring: The agent scans incoming email for messages from known vendors, classifies them by type (quote, invoice, delivery confirmation, dispute, renewal), and routes them appropriately — so the right person sees the right document without sorting through a shared inbox.
  • Document data extraction: Quotes and invoices arrive in PDF, email body, or spreadsheet formats. The agent extracts key fields — vendor, line items, quantities, prices, totals, payment terms — and structures them for comparison and logging.
  • Purchase order matching: Extracted invoice data is automatically compared against the corresponding purchase order. Matched invoices proceed; discrepancies are flagged with a summary of what doesn’t align, ready for a human to review and decide.
  • Exception routing: When the agent identifies a pricing discrepancy, a missing document, an overdue response, or a renewal approaching its deadline, it creates an exception record and notifies the appropriate team member with the relevant context.
  • Vendor performance tracking: Delivery confirmations, response times, and exception rates are logged over time, giving operations managers a running view of supplier reliability without requiring manual tracking.
  • Quote comparison and summary: When multiple vendors submit quotes for the same item or service, the agent structures the submissions into a comparable format and surfaces a summary — so the sourcing decision is faster and better-informed.

Integration connects to your existing email infrastructure and ERP or procurement platform. Most implementations can be configured to work with the document and communication patterns already in use at your company, without requiring vendors to change how they send information.

Procurement efficiency is not about negotiating harder. It is about having accurate, timely information — knowing what was agreed, what arrived, what was billed, and what doesn’t match. An agent provides that visibility without the manual effort.

What are the benefits

The impact of a vendor and procurement agent is visible across three dimensions: staff time reclaimed from low-value extraction work, fewer errors in the procure-to-pay cycle, and better visibility into supplier performance and spend.

  • Faster invoice processing: Automated extraction and matching shortens the time from invoice receipt to approval, reducing the delays that strain supplier relationships and create late payment risk.
  • Fewer undetected exceptions: When matching runs automatically on every invoice, discrepancies don’t slip through because someone was too busy to check. Every exception gets flagged, every time.
  • Reduced administrative burden on operations staff: Time previously spent opening attachments and transcribing data shifts to higher-value activities — supplier relationship management, sourcing strategy, and contract review.
  • Better spend visibility: Structured data from every transaction accumulates into a clean record of what was purchased, from whom, at what price — enabling better spend analysis and category management without manual reporting effort.
  • Proactive renewal and deadline management: The agent tracks contract end dates and renewal windows, alerting the team before deadlines arrive rather than after they’ve passed.
  • Consistent process quality: The same checks run on every document, regardless of volume or staffing level. Process quality doesn’t degrade when the team is short-staffed or dealing with a high-volume period.

As the agent processes more transactions and supplier interactions, it builds a richer picture of vendor behavior — response times, exception rates, pricing consistency — that feeds directly into sourcing decisions and supplier reviews.
